Pink Perfection: Barbie’s Signature Color

A little bit of food coloring can go a long way in creating food with the iconic Barbie pink. Take a look at some of our favorite pink Barbie party food ideas!

Some great ways to incorporate the color pink into your party foods are,

  • Pink frosting
  • Pink sugar cookies
  • Pink fizzy drinks
  • Pink cupcakes
  • Pink ice cream

DIY Food Stations for Fun

A great way to keep kids entertained is to set up an interactive food station that allows your guests to customize their own edible delights.

Some great DIY food stations include:

  • Cupcake decorating
  • Cookie decorating
  • Mini-cake decorating
  • Ice-cream sundae bar

DIY food stations are great ways to get kids to use their imaginations and express their creativity while also getting a sweet treat!

Here are a few great tips on setting up your DIY station:

  • Fill colorful bowls with toppings.
  • Prepare small individual icing bags for each child.
  • Pink spoons for scooping.
  • Place topping on a lazy-susan.
  • Arrange your undecorated desserts so they are easily accessible to tiny hands.
  • Make decoration goodie bags for each child, to minimize mess and food waste.
  • Have your young guests choose their toppings and have a grown-up decorate the dessert.
  • Place desserts on cookie sheets for easy clean up and preventing big messes
